      My idea commemorates cancer survivors. My piece is for cancer survivors, patients and their support people. My piece will show the survivor that they aren't alone and that there are others supporting them and that no matter what, we still love them. 

    The process of making this piece was thinking about shapes that represent strength. I used spheres because I wanted to represent a cancer survivor with others surrounding them, showing that the cancer survivor is not alone. I used clay first, but the final piece is made out of carving foam. I am confident my piece looks like it represents strength. I’m learning that the triangle is not the only shape that represents strength, but how you put other shapes together. For example, I use circles for my piece but I surrounded it with circles and it made my piece look stronger because the circles are not alone; they are all together.
